Mike Fair - Director, Real Estate Instructor


Mike Fair Mike Fair is the Director and President of the recently merged Illinois Academy of Real Estate and Your House Academy. Mike has developed and instructed real estate courses since 1984 and has helped thousands of students pass their real estate exams.

Mike joined the real estate business in 1974 and his experience includes: new home construction, real estate sales, property management, real estate office management, financing, and education. Mike has served as content advisor for Dearborn Financial Publishing, Hondros College and Applied Measurement Professionals (AMP), Illinois’ exam provider.

He is a member of the National Association of Realtors®, the Illinois Association of Realtors®, the Real Estate Educator’s Association, and the Association of Illinois Real Estate Educators. In 2016, Mike received the organization’s important Educator of the Year Award, the second year in a row in which Your House Academy’s teachers have won this award.

Mike is happily married to his wife Laurie and has five adult children and five grandchildren. His students enjoy and appreciate Mike’s intelligent, gentle, no nonsense approach to teaching.

A REALTOR® is a licensed real estate agent who is a member of the National Association of REALTORS®, (NAR) the largest trade group in the country.

Every agent is not a REALTOR®.  You become a REALTOR® after you pass your real estate course, pass the state license exam, join a real estate company and then join the National Association of REALTORS®.

According to the NAR, the term REALTOR has one, and only one, meaning:
"REALTOR® is a federally registered collective membership mark which identifies a real estate professional who is a member of the National Association of REALTORS® and subscribes to its strict Code of Ethics."
